What Is a Trichologist?

A trichologist is a specialist who cares for your scalp and hair.
They spot problems like dandruff, dry scalp, alopecia, or damaged hair follicles.
Unlike dermatologists who treat many skin issues, trichologists focus on hair and scalp alone.

How Trichologists Help Your Hair

Trichologists examine your scalp closely.
They use tools like scalp microscopes to check follicles and skin conditions.
They give advice and create treatment plans.
They rely on scalp massages, topical treatments, and lifestyle changes to improve hair growth, reduce hair fall, and soothe irritation.

Common Hair and Scalp Problems Treated by Trichologists

1. Hair Thinning and Hair Loss (Alopecia)

Hair loss may come from genetics, stress, hormone changes, or diet.
Trichologists check if hair loss is temporary (telogen effluvium) or permanent (androgenetic alopecia).
They use scalp stimulation, dietary tips, and natural shampoos to help.

2. Dandruff and Dry Scalp

A flaky, itchy scalp causes discomfort and embarrassment.
Trichologists find shampoos and topical remedies that restore moisture and reduce flaking without harsh chemicals.

3. Scalp Psoriasis and Dermatitis

Some people get psoriasis or seborrheic dermatitis.
These conditions cause redness and scaling.
Trichologists recommend medicated shampoos and gentle cleansing to calm irritation.

4. Scalp Folliculitis

Inflamed follicles hurt and cause patchy hair loss.
A trichologist may suggest antibacterial treatments and hygiene habits to ease the pain.

How to Find a Good Trichologist in Hounslow

When you look for your expert, keep these in mind:

Qualifications: Check that they are certified or recognized by bodies like The Institute of Trichologists in the UK.
Experience: Look for a solid record and positive testimonials.
Approach: Find someone who listens and prefers natural, holistic methods.
Accessibility: Confirm the clinic’s location, hours, and after-care support.

Many local trichologists even offer virtual consultations so you can get advice from home.


What to Expect During Your Trichology Consultation

Your first visit will usually include:

• A talk about your hair history, lifestyle, diet, and any medications you use.
• A close look at your scalp with high-magnification cameras.
• A check for scalp conditions and patterns of hair loss.
• Custom advice that may include shampoo suggestions, supplements, or minor treatments.

Follow-up visits help track progress and adjust your plan.

Q3: Can scalp massage really stimulate hair growth?

Yes.
A gentle scalp massage increases blood flow.
This nourishes hair follicles and makes your hair stronger.
A trichologist will show you the best technique.

Q4: How long does it take to see results from trichological treatments?

Hair growth takes time.
Most people see improvement in 3 to 6 months with regular care and the right products.

Q5: Are diet and nutrition really important for healthy hair?

Yes.
Your hair needs vitamins, minerals, and proteins to grow strong.
A balanced diet with biotin, zinc, iron, and vitamins A and C helps your follicles.
